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43623018 79 738 2367400
535435811 702547 96795918
535435811 702547 96795918
8689174 31 261647116 77
All about undefined
Interested in learning more?
535435811 702547 96795918
8689174 31 261647116 77
See more
860090095 15823450 342151
090474 5335299893 6469906506
See more
55149 5702 4094427540
824063 83 720
See more